At Furze Platt, ticket purchasing is streamlined with operational ticket machines available, although it's worth noting that tickets bought online cannot be collected at this station. The station is equipped to issue smartcards but doesn't provide validators. Accessibility features include step-free access through a short steep ramp, ensuring those with mobility needs are accommodated. However, accessible facilities such as toilets and car park equipment are not available. The station is under CCTV surveillance for safety!
During the weekdays, from 06:45 to 11:30, staff are on hand to offer help from a designated help point, ready to facilitate a smooth and stress-free travel experience. While there are no luggage storage facilities, rest assured that you can seek assistance and real-time updates from the customer information systems available on-site. Furze Platt might not boast lounge areas or Wi-Fi access, but it ensures essential support for its commuters.

Smethwick Galton Bridge station caters to traveler needs with essential facilities and amenities. The ticket office is open on select days, with extended hours on Fridays, and ticket machines are present for added convenience. However, while you can collect tickets bought online, note that there are no accessible ticket machines. There's also an induction loop available for passengers with hearing impairments.
The station prides itself on its accessibility features. As a step-free access category A station, it offers ease of access to all platforms. While waiting for your journey, you can find a seating area as well as an accessible toilet facility. Assistance is available during specific hours, ensuring every traveler, including those needing additional help, has a pleasant experience at the station.
For those continuing their journey beyond the train, Smethwick Galton Bridge provides several options. Local bus services link from public service bus stops located on Oldbury Road, right at the front of the station. If you're catching a taxi, companies such as Cedar, Bearwood, and Redline offer services, ensuring a smooth transition from train to your next destination. Parking at the station is handled by Transport for West Midlands, offering 82 spaces, with five dedicated accessible spaces. While parking is free, please note that there’s no CCTV coverage in the car park. For cyclists, 20 bicycle storage spaces are sheltered, though no facilities are available for bicycle hire.
Smethwick Galton Bridge provides some essential services like pay phones but lacks amenities such as Wi-Fi, refreshments, and shop facilities. Nonetheless, the station offers a safe environment overseen by CCTV for added security.
